Subject: [PATCH 1/5] sched: Rename init_rq_hrtick to hrtick_rq_init
Date: Thu, 21 Dec 2017 18:14:45 +0100 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<1513876489-11057-2-git-send-email-frederic@kernel.org>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<1513876489-11057-1-git-send-email-frederic@kernel.org>
Do that rename in order to normalize the hrtick namespace.
